Incident Summary:

09/28/2001: Maoist guerrillas belonging to the People’s War Group shot and killed M. Ghandi, a policeman, who was preparing to testify in a case against a member of their group in Saluru, India. The perpetrators also gunned down the policeman’s bodyguard outside the courtroom. No group claimed responsibility for the killing.
